COLUMBIA, S.C. – Despite a late surge, Kentucky State fell to Benedict 83-67 on Saturday in SIAC play at HRC Arena.
Jeana Weatherspoon led the Thorobreds (4-10, 3-4 SIAC) with 16 points, adding six rebounds and a steal.
Bailey Ford contributed 14 points, while
Khalia Bryant recorded nine points and seven rebounds.
Benedict (4-7, 3-4 SIAC) capitalized on turnovers, scoring 25 points off 23 Kentucky State giveaways. Taylor Christmas paced the Tigers with 24 points on 11-of-13 shooting and added six rebounds. Alaysia Nash added 15 points, while Ciara Hardy chipped in 12.
The Thorobreds showed resilience in the fourth quarter, outscoring Benedict 26-19, but the deficit proved too great.
